03、MongoDB实战:MongoDB的数据类型

本文详细介绍了MongoDB支持的所有数据类型,包括String、Integer、Boolean、Double、Array、Date、ObjectID等,并解释了每种类型的用途和特点,帮助开发者更好地理解和设计MongoDB数据库模式。

MongoDB 的数据类型

数据类型秒速
String字符串。存储数据常用的数据类型。在MongoDB中,UTF-8编码的字符串才是合法的
Integer整型数值。用于存储数值。根据你所采用的服务器,可分为32位和62位
Boolean布尔值。用于存储布尔值(真/假)
Double双精度浮点数。用于存储浮点值
Min/Max keys将一个值与BSON(二进制的JSON)元素的最低值和最高值相对比
Array用于将数组或列表或多个值存储为一个键
Timestamp时间戳。记录文档修改或添加的具体时间
Object用于内嵌文档
Null用于创建空值
Symbol符号。该数据类型基本上等同于字符串类型,但不同的是,它一般用于采用特殊符号类型的语言
Date日期时间。用UNIX时间格式来存储当前日期或时间。你可以指定自己的日期时间:创建Date对象,传入年月日信息
Object ID对象ID。用于创建文档的ID
Binary Data二进制数据。用于存储二进制数据
Code代码类型。用于在文档中存储JavaScript代码
Regular expression正则表达式类型。用于存储正则表达式

版权声明:本文不是「本站」原创文章,版权归原作者所有 | 原文地址: